Bulgarian servicepersons from the country's Joint Forces Command and 61st Stryama Mechanized Infantry Brigade took part in Gordian Knot 2023, a computer-assisted command-post exercise of the NATO Rapid Deployable Corps - Greece. It was held at Camp Prokopidi near Thessaloniki between November 6 and 17, the Bulgarian Defence Ministry reported on Friday.
The drill involved over 500 staff officers from 13 NATO member states and representatives of NATO commands.
It was aimed to enhance the knowledge and skills of the participants and to practice the implementation of tasks related to the planning and conduct of a large-scale joint operation in the conditions of Article 5 of the Washington Treaty.
